Output 103663156e9e5d55ad0a2c4408e5186d63c2891a6868e5a57c98ec428ca62f25:1

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2df51c66f4f20dbf2609e3c0bb18b5ee396e6a02 OP_EQUALVERIFY OP_CHECKSIG
address
15C13EtZAbCZKkfaRQzW8i1PmFZ9T67Hyo
transaction
103663156e9e5d55ad0a2c4408e5186d63c2891a6868e5a57c98ec428ca62f25
spent
true